About Hannah

Hannah Padilla is a Licensed Professional Counselor - LPC who brings four years of clinical experience supporting adolescents and adults through a range of emotional and life challenges. She holds a Bachelor of Arts in Psychology from Texas A&M International University and a Master of Forensic Psychology from the University of Houston, and she has completed specialized training in trauma-focused approaches including Trauma-Focused Cognitive Behavioral Therapy and Cognitive Processing Therapy.

Hannah typically grounds her work in cognitive behavioral methods while maintaining a person-centered stance that emphasizes empathy, respect, and collaboration. She has particular experience helping people who have survived sexual abuse, physical abuse, domestic violence, and neglect, and she works with clients on anxiety, self-esteem, grief, PTSD, depression, relationship concerns, boundary setting, and anger management. Her practice also addresses a wide range of related issues such as attachment concerns, body image, codependency, dissociation, and family problems.

In sessions, Hannah aims to combine warmth and challenge - offering steady support while encouraging clients to identify unhelpful beliefs, confront negative thoughts, and build practical skills for daily living. She helps clients develop tools for emotional regulation, distress tolerance, and interpersonal effectiveness so they can pursue meaningful change and improved well-being.

Therapeutic Approaches and Online Care with Hannah Padilla

Hannah Padilla uses client-centered therapy to create a supportive, nonjudgmental space where the client's experience guides the work. This approach emphasizes empathy, respect, and collaboration, and it can be especially helpful for building self-esteem, exploring identity, and navigating relationship or family concerns.

She also applies Cognitive Behavioral Therapy - CBT to identify and change patterns of thinking and behavior that contribute to anxiety, depression, trauma reactions, and stress. CBT offers concrete skills for recognizing automatic thoughts, challenging unhelpful beliefs, and practicing new coping strategies in everyday situations.

Mindfulness therapy is another tool Hannah incorporates to help clients develop present-moment awareness and improved emotional regulation. Mindfulness techniques can support stress reduction, decrease reactivity, and enhance the ability to tolerate difficult feelings.

Finding the right approach is a collaborative process. Hannah works with each client to assess needs, goals, and preferences, and she tailors methods over time so the work fits the individual. Licensed professionals often combine techniques to match changing priorities and stages of therapy.
